What is the new cost if a $2.75 toy is marked up by 29%?

Answer:

$3.55

Step-by-step explanation:

You need to add 29% of $2.75 to $2.75.

That means the price will be 129% of $2.75.

129% of $2.75 =

= 1.29 * $2.75

= $3.55
